Ordinals
beta
Address DKXDg2ugZhgJqrsPej6jwuR1o9GCnhCf6q
sat balance
280200
runes balances
outputs
905c9a150e4abb58b5d8b6690f8b81202a2e653844231709eb080b29c98d74a1:1